在把 TP 钱包升级到最新版本时,必须把功能更新与安全治理并列为首要任务:既要确保用户资产和私密数据零泄露,也要为未来商业生态与合约监控建立可扩展的能力。以下为实战级技术指南。
准备阶段:先完整备份助记词与加密 keystore,建议离线、分段、多介质存储并做密钥分散(Shamir 或多方分割);记录当前版本与配置,便于回滚。
获取与验证:只从官方域名或应用商店下载安装包,使用发布方签名验证、SHA256 校验和与代码签名证书链验证;对 Android APK 做二进制签名比对,Apple 版使用 App Store 校验;必要时核对开发者公钥指纹。
安装流程(阶段性部署):先在沙盒/测试设备上安装并执行自动化回归测试;进行 canary 放量,监控崩溃率与交易异常;提供一键回滚与强制更新策略。


合约监控与自治防护:启用链上事件监听器、流水线化解析器与规则引擎(阈值、异常模式);结合预言机与行为白名单实现自动暂停或熔断;将告警推送至 SIEM 与运维台,建立快速处置 playbook。
私密数据存储:始终采用端侧加密(用户密钥不可出设备),优先使用安全元件/TEE;对云端采用加密分片或可验证加密(如同态或零知识证明场景),静态与传输中均加密,实施定期密钥轮换与最小权限访问。
防钓鱼与界面完整性:实现域名与证书钉扎、交易详情本地化渲染、签名预览与双重确认;采用行为学黑名单、视觉相似度检测与 URL 仿冒识别;教育弹窗与可疑交易阻断。
防光学攻击策略:对二维码与助记词展示引入一次性或时间窗二维码、随机化视觉噪声、移动验证码与双屏验证;在关键操作启用屏幕遮挡提示与外设隔离,降低摄像头与窃视风险。
信息化与持续交付:建立可溯源 CI/CD、重现性构建、签名化发布与 OTA 安全通道;结合静态/动态分析与第三方审计,维护公开漏洞赏金计划。
风险管理与演练:在升级前做风险评估与演练(模拟钓鱼、回滚、合约异常),上线后 24/7 倍频监控与事后审计;制定赔付与法律合规流程,确保业务生态可持续演进。
总结流程:备份→验证来源→沙盒测试→分阶段部署→合约与链上监控→私密存储与密钥治理→反钓与反光学防护→持续监控与风险演练。遵循此链路,可把 TP 钱包升级变成一次增强安全与生态能力的机会。
评论